Curly hair can be a challenge to style due to its complicated nature so it's important to pick the correct styling tool, in this case a blow dryer, in order to obtain the fastest and best results without compromising your hair's health. Curly hair tends to dry out easily, and must require extra moisture and care when blow drying. The natural oils and moisture produced in your scalp don't often make it all the way down your locks, so a blow dryer that doesn't dry out your locks too much is ideal. With curls, you almost always have to deal with frizz and using a mediocre blow dryer can make this problem worse. A powerful motor and constant, high temperatures are the best things for curly hair, however this doesn't mean you can choose any blow dryer that just blasts out hot air. What you need is a professional model, one that matches your styling needs and is made with quality materials that make the product durable and functional. Check for powerful motors that can handle 1800 watts or more and high temperatures, since curly hair requires a lot of heat. A continuous airflow can dry your curls a lot quicker, therefore reducing heat damage since you don't have to point the blow dryer at your hair for too long. Being able to control the styling process when you have curls is also important, so check that the blow dryer you are purchasing lets you change the temperature settings and use the cool shot button. A diffuser attachment is very useful for drying curls and enhancing their natural texture, so consider getting one with your blow dryer if it doesn't already come with one.
